How To Add a Coronavirus FAQ App on Google Sites:

  1. Create a Free Coronavirus FAQ App

    Start for free now
  2. Copy HTML code

    Your code block will be available once you create your app

  3. Embed code in Google Sites

    Insert an embed code block and paste code from the first step
  4. Preview and Publish your live Coronavirus FAQ

    Click on the computer icon in the top hand menu to Preview and Publish when it’s looking good
  5. Edit POWR Coronavirus FAQ

    To edit your plugin, click the Edit Icon seen above Coronavirus FAQ extension. This will open a second window containing the POWR Editor.
